Select the correct iPod adapter as the table below to matching your iPod. iPod Adapter #8 - iPod Nano (1st Gen, 2nd Gen, 4th Gen)iPod Adapter #10 - iPod (4th Gen, 5th Gen (Video), iPod Classic)iPod Adapter #13 - iPod Nano (3rd Gen)iPod Adapter #14 - iPod Touch (1st Gen, 2nd Gen) 2...
Page 12 - Specifications are subject to change without notice.; General Specification:
Power Source: AC~120V, 60HzPower Source of Remote Control: DC 3V, 1 x “CR2032” size battery (Included) Power Consumption: 14 WattAudio Output Power: 2 Watt/ChannelRadio Frequency: AM 530-1710 KHz, FM 88 -108 MHz Accessories:1 x Instruction Manual 4 x iPod docking adaptors1 x Remote Control (1 x CR 2...
